Authorizing the Arrest and Detention of Any Person Involved in Crimes against Persons and Property under the Revised Penal Code, and Other Crimes under the Same Code and Other Special Laws, When the Offense is Committed against a Foreign Tourist, Transient or Traveler
General Order No. 36, issued on August 1, 1973, allows for the arrest and detention of individuals involved in crimes against persons and property, specifically when such offenses are committed against foreign tourists, transients, or travelers. This order amends previous directives to include various serious crimes, including grave threats, rape, and acts of lasciviousness, as punishable offenses under the Revised Penal Code and other special laws. Cases arising from these arrests must be tried by designated Military Tribunals within 24 hours of filing by the arresting officers. The order aims to enhance the protection of foreign visitors in the Philippines.

Full Law Text
August 1, 1973
GENERAL ORDER NO. 36
AUTHORIZING THE ARREST AND DETENTION OF ANY PERSON INVOLVED IN CRIMES AGAINST PERSONS AND PROPERTY UNDER THE REVISED PENAL CODE, AND OTHER CRIMES UNDER THE SAME CODE AND OTHER SPECIAL LAWS, WHEN THE OFFENSE IS COMMITTED AGAINST A FOREIGN TOURIST, TRANSIENT OR TRAVELER
General Order No. 2 dated September 22, 1972 as Amended by General Order Nos. 2-A, 2-B, 2-C and No. 29, is hereby amended to include the following provisions:
No. 23 — Any person or persons who may have been known or found to have committed any crime against persons and property as defined and penalized under the Revised Penal Code and other offenses under the same Code, such as Grave Threats, Art. 282; Rape, Art. 335; Acts of Lasciviousness, Art. 336; Seduction, Art. 337; Corruption of Minors, Art. 340; White Slave Trade, Art. 341; Forcible Abduction, Art. 342 and Consented Abduction, Art. 343, and other violation of special laws, when the offense is committed against a foreign tourist, transient or traveler.
One of the Military Tribunals constituted under General Order No. 8 dated September 27, 1972, shall be assigned by the Commander-in-Chief, Armed Forces of the Philippines, or his duly authorized representative, to try and decide the cases involving person or persons arrested and detained by virtue of this Order within twenty four hours after the said case or cases shall have been filed with the said tribunals by the arresting officers.
DONE in the City of Manila, this 1st day of August, in the year of Our Lord, nineteen hundred and seventy-three.
